推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
NICE命令是Linux操作系统中用于调整进程优先级的核心工具。通过设置进程的优先级,可以影响系统的负载均衡和资源分配。使用nice命令可以改变进程的优先级,其值范围从-20到19,数值越大,优先级越低。通过合理使用NICE命令,用户可以优化系统性能,确保关键任务获得足够的资源。
本文目录导读:
在Linux系统中,每个进程都有其优先级,而NICE命令正是用来调整进程优先级的关键工具,本文将详细介绍NICE命令的原理、使用方法及其在系统中的应用。
NICE命令的原理
NICE命令的作用是在不影响系统负载的情况下,调整进程的优先级,在Linux系统中,进程的优先级范围是从-20到19,数值越高,优先级越低,NICE命令的值范围也是从-20到19,数值越大,进程的优先级越低,当一个进程启动时,它会有一定的默认优先级,而NICE命令可以在这个基础上调整优先级。
NICE命令的使用方法
NICE命令的基本用法如下:
nice [OPTION]... [COMMAND] [ARGUMENT]...
OPTION
是可选参数,COMMAND
是要执行的命令,ARGUMENT
是命令的参数。
1、基本用法:
nice [优先级] [命令] [参数]
将命令ls
的优先级调整为-10:
nice -10 ls
2、与其他命令结合:
NICE命令可以与其他命令组合使用,
nice -5 emacs -nw &
这个命令将emacs
的优先级调整为-5,然后以背景进程运行。
3、设置环境变量:
还可以通过设置环境变量NICE
来改变默认的优先级调整值,将默认优先级设置为-5:
export NICE=-5
然后在执行命令时,就不需要再指定优先级参数:
nice ls
NICE命令在系统中的应用
1、调整后台服务优先级:
对于一些不需要特别关注响应时间的后台服务,可以使用NICE命令将其优先级调整得较高,从而让CPU资源更倾向于分配给前台交互式进程。
2、优化计算任务:
对于一些计算密集型的任务,可以通过NICE命令将其优先级调整得较低,避免占用过多的CPU资源,从而让CPU资源得到更合理的分配。
3、防止进程占用过多资源:
通过NICE命令,可以防止某些进程占用过多的系统资源,从而保证系统的稳定运行。
NICE命令是Linux系统中调整进程优先级的核心工具,通过合理使用NICE命令,可以优化系统资源的分配,提高系统性能,掌握NICE命令的使用,对于Linux系统管理员和开发人员来说,都是非常重要的技能。
下面是根据文章生成的50个中文相关关键词:
NICE命令,进程优先级,Linux系统,调整优先级,系统负载,优先级范围,默认优先级,命令参数,背景进程,环境变量,NICE值,后台服务,CPU资源,交互式进程,计算密集型任务,计算任务,资源分配,系统稳定,系统性能,管理员技能,开发人员技能,Linux命令,进程管理,系统优化,资源管理,性能调优,任务调度,后台运行,进程参数,命令组合,环境设置,进程监控,资源监控,系统监控,性能监控,任务管理,调度策略,系统维护,运维技能,自动化运维.
本文标签属性:
nice命令调整进程优先级:哪个命令可以改变进程的优先级